Endometriosis: A Decades-Long Struggle

Parton’s health battles did not begin in 2025. She experienced severe abdominal pain and bleeding that led to a diagnosis of endometriosis – a condition where tissue similar to the uterine lining grows outside the uterus. She canceled a tour in 1982 due to her health.

According to the American College of Obstetricians and Gynecologists, endometriosis occurs in about 1 in 10 women of reproductive age. It commonly causes intense pelvic pain, especially during menstruation, and can make conception difficult or impossible.

Parton underwent a partial hysterectomy at age 36, which meant she and Dean never had children. Parton spoke about this over the years with characteristic candor, describing both the physical ordeal and the emotional weight of learning she could not carry children.

The physical suffering during this period also contributed to a serious mental health crisis. She described a period in her 30s marked by eating problems, digestive issues, and emotional collapse. She later discussed having considered suicide during that time, and said she recovered by making a deliberate effort to pull herself back – a process she acknowledged was neither quick nor easy.

Kidney Stones: A Recurring Condition

Parton had dealt with kidney stones since at least 2015, when she confirmed she had stones removed in order to counter tabloid speculation about stomach cancer. The problem continued to affect her in the years that followed, including the September 2025 infection that caused her to miss the Dollywood event.

Kidney stones are hard, pebble-like deposits that form inside the kidneys when certain minerals concentrate in urine. According to the National Institute of Diabetes and Digestive and Kidney Diseases, a stone that becomes lodged can block urine flow, causing severe pain and, if untreated, infection.
